  2. words evolve - like viruses and spread - like memes scaff OED: “to eat voraciously” earliest English usage 1762, unknown origin scoff OED: “to eat voraciously” earliest English usage 1798 (variant /alteration of scaff) scarf OED: “food” earliest American usage 1932 (variant /alteration of scoff /scaff)

  15. JUST FRIENDS (Gewoon Vrienden) 2018 - 80 minutes Enjoyable, well-scripted, quality production Dutch TV movie. Joris (right) is an introvert gym-bunny from an affluent family. He doesn’t know what to do with his life, so plays with his camera drone. Yad (left) is a party person but money is tight (his family are Syrian migrants). He also doesn’t know what to do with his life, so takes a cleaning job to pay his rent - cleaning for Joris’s grandma (middle ) It’s a gentle romcom (they’re both ‘out’) with the usual story arc - meeting, attraction, tensions, breakup and resolution - but touches on some serious issues along the way. A feel-good movie perfect for a Valentine’s night in, on the sofa 💕 I snagged a DVD for a few pounds (which includes a gay movie short, ‘Caged (2013),’ with the same actor who plays Joris) and various copies (original Dutch soundtrack) are posted on YouTube (and other sites) but I couldn’t find one with proper English subtitles/captions (Portuguese in the link here and 720p pic quality in the YouTube app. You can select auto translate but it’s AI…):

Trainspotting Factoids #1 dialogue in the 1996 movie is in “Scots” dialect (some say language) - if you’ve seen the movie you’ll have needed subtitles #2 the book (and movie) are named after “trainspotters” who (some say obsessively ) chase after +record (in notebooks, pics or vids) seemingly trivial (some say pointless ) information like loco numbers #3 Irvine Welsh says he chose this name “because only trainspotters can understand why they spot trains” and he compared the act of spotting trains to “the act of using heroin, which may seem pointless to people who don't use it” #4 trainspotting originated in England - 1841 is the earliest record (Colonel James Pennyman - trains on the Great North of England Railway), which is quite late considering locos had been operating commercially almost 30 years since 1812 #5 a huge chunk of British YouTube channels are trainspotters #6 not to be confused with bus spotting - same activities, but different folk mostly separate from trainspotters, although there is some overlap eg Nathan:

  25. the most important item in any British home …because the whole tea-making process must be completed within the 3 minute TV ad breaks So many people (millions) turn on their kettles at the exact same time that the UK has had to build special power stations underneath mountains that go from zero to max output in seconds in order to cope with the load and highly-qualified engineers carefully scrutinise the TV guides so they can flip the switches seconds before the ad break starts and prevent the entire electricity distribution system from exploding https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/TV_pickup#:~:text=TV pickups occur during breaks,demand on the electrical grid. https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Dinorwig_Power_Station
